M12 Power K-/S-Coded Push/Pull Connectors

HARTING M12 Power K- and S-Coded Push/Pull Connectors are reliable circular connectors that provide fast and easy connection in high vibration environments. These connectors feature a robust housing and reliable locking system with an audible click indicating a connection. The K- and S-Coded M12 connectors offer 360° shielding, a 630V rating, a 12A current, and ≥100 mating cycle durability within a -40°C to +125°C limiting temperature range. The HARTING M12 Power K- and S-Coded Push/Pull Connectors are ideal for field installations, panel feed-throughs (PFTs) with single wires, and device integration onto a PCB.
